Top Ten Most Dangerous Sports in the World

Sports are generally for entertainment and adventure but few sports or games are too hazardous to take part in. Earlier sports were only viewed or played for entertainment purpose, now some more factors has been added into the list which includes thrill, danger and adventure. We are bringing a list of some sports which are very dangerous to play.

1. Heli Skiing: This is a very dangerous sport to take part in as all the conditions in this game are very dangerous and hard to face. This game becomes very popular since its beginning in 1960’s and the majorly popular areas for these games are Canadian and British Colombia territory. Heli-skiing is done by skiing on a mountain covered with snow which is accessed with the help of a helicopter which lifts the ski person to a high altitude. This game is very difficult as a little mistake can lead to a huge accident. Recently many skiers had lost their lives in this because of accidents.

2. Bull Riding: This is another very dangerous sport in which the rider sits on the bull and tries to maintain the balance till the bull hurls him away. This is a very scary sport even for the viewers, the bull riding is mostly famous in Mexico. The rider has to ride the bull for at least 8 seconds with one of his hands being fastened to the rope which is tied up with the bulls flank. Many riders faced physical injuries and few of them lead to death also. This is a very dangerous sport and also called as “the most dangerous 8 seconds in sports”.

3. Cave Diving: Cave diving is a very hazardous sport in which the diver dives into a cave which is partially filled with water and has to find out the route to the exit point. This is a very risky sport as the diver faces some serious obstacles like lack of oxygen, the slender passage caves and no sunlight. Sometimes the temperature also creates a serious problem for this sport. This is a combination of underwater diving and scuba diving. The equipments used in this sport are somewhat different from the scuba diving. The life of the divers is always in a risk as they have to manage every situation themselves because the rescue team may take some time to come.

4. Base jumping: The Base Jumping is a sport in which the person jumps from a very high place and later opens the parachute to stop their fall. This sport is so dangerous and also known as B.A.S.E. which is acronym for the Buildings, Antennas, Spans (bridges) and Earth. This sport is dangerous because once the jumper jumps there is no control over any mishap, what if the parachute does not open. There is always a risk in this game. This game is banner in most of the countries. Another form of this game is ski diving which is almost similar to this.

5. Big Wave Surfing: Big Wave surfing looks a little easy to see but when you enters into the water with some huge tides almost 50-60 ft it’s very difficult to make a move under these situation. The surfing boards which the surfers used are known as “guns” and the size of the boards are decided by the surfer depending upon the conditions and the surfing techniques. A surfer surfs on these conditions until a big wave pushes him under the surface almost 20-50 ft down. The time left to come up is only about 20 seconds until the second wave comes. The pressure of the water is so high that it can even damage your eardrums and make you drown into the water.

6. Street Luging: The street luging was started in 1975 in Southern California and is earlier known as “laydown skateboarding”. In this game the person lays down on the board and rolls on the street, this is quite interesting for the viewers but equivalent risky for the players who are competing. There is no condition of applying breaks. The speeds of the skateboards are so high that even a small accident can lead to a very major injury.

7. Bull Running: This is a very famous sport in Spain, a group of bulls are loosened free on the streets and people run in front of the bulls. This is a very dangerous sport as no one has any control over the bulls. The streets are blocked in such a manner that only one route remains open on which the bulls run. So many people lost their lives in this sport every year.

8. Cheerleading: The Cheerleading was introduced in the United States and was presented first by the cheerleaders to the global audience in 1997. After being seen, this sport becomes very famous and thousands of participants enrolled themselves into this sport every year. This sport requires a lot of physical strength and concentration as a small mistake can lead to a serious injury or can fracture the bone. The main attraction in this sport is the stunts performed by the girls as they are quite vulnerable.

9. Motorcycle Racing: This sport is so famous in the youngsters as the speed from which the fast superbikes roars the track looks so amazing. Professional training is given to all the racers who participate in the race. Although the tracks are well maintained and medical facilities are present in the circuit still this is a very dangerous sport as its very difficult to control the speed on which they drives their superbikes. Many racers have lost their lives in the accidents.

10. High Altitude Climbing: This sport is also famous by the name of trekking. On high altitude mountains climbing are done, it can be done in various climatic conditions. This sport is very dangerous and there’s always a risk of life in this sport. Climbing the huge mountains with just the support of harnessed ropes is very risky throughout
the climbing period as a small mistake can take your life away.
